Sandisk · 17 hours ago
New College Grad, ASIC Verification Engineering
Sandisk is a company that specializes in innovative data solutions and semiconductor technologies. They are seeking a detail-oriented professional to join their IP team in Milpitas as a Senior Engineer in ASIC Development Engineering, focusing on creating high-performance semiconductor solutions.
Data StorageManufacturingSemiconductor
Responsibilities
Test Planning and Effort Scoping: Comprehend IP architecture and design specifications and create detailed verification plans. Review with cross-functional teams and create execution plan (Gantt chart) for effort scoping
Verification Environment Development: Develop a robust verification environment for IP blocks using SystemVerilog and UVM (Universal Verification Methodology)
Test Development & Debug: Develop directed and constrained-random tests per test plan and bring up tests. Debug simulation failures, and report bugs in bug tracking system (e.g., Jira)
Regression & Coverage: Run regression and analyze code and functional coverage, improve test quality to ensure 100% verification completeness
IP Release Management: Participate in the IP release process, ensuring that IPs meet quality criteria for each milestone before delivery to SoC team
Documentation: Document verification plans, test reports, and known issues
Qualification
Required
Bachelor's or Master's degree in Electrical Engineering, Computer Engineering, or Computer Science
Strong understanding of digital logic design, computer architecture, and finite state machines
Proficiency in Hardware Description Languages, specifically Verilog or SystemVerilog
Familiarity with industry-standard simulation tools (e.g., Synopsys VCS, Cadence Xcelium, or Siemens Questa)
Solid understanding of Object-Oriented Programming (OOP) concepts (C++, SystemVerilog OOP)
Competence in scripting languages such as Python, C-shell, or Bash for automating tasks and parsing logs
Excellent problem-solving skill, attention to detail, and strong written/verbal communication skills to work effectively in a collaborative team environment
Preferred
Basic knowledge or coursework exposure to UVM (Universal Verification Methodology) components (drivers, monitors, scoreboards)
Experience with revision control systems like Git
Familiarity with standard bus protocols (AMBA AXI/AHB/APB) or specific interfaces (DDR, PCIe, SPI) is a plus
Experience with or interest in utilizing AI-based tools (e.g., Github Copilot) to assist in coding, script generation, or automating verification workflows
Experience working in a Linux/Unix environment
Benefits
Paid vacation time
Paid sick leave
Medical/dental/vision insurance
Life, accident and disability insurance
Tax-advantaged flexible spending and health savings accounts
Employee assistance program
Other voluntary benefit programs such as supplemental life and AD&D, legal plan, pet insurance, critical illness, accident and hospital indemnity
Tuition reimbursement
Transit
The Applause Program
Employee stock purchase plan
Sandisk's Savings 401(k) Plan
Company
Sandisk
SanDisk designs, develops, manufactures, and markets data storage solutions in the United States and internationally.
H1B Sponsorship
Sandisk has a track record of offering H1B sponsorships. Please note that this does not
guarantee sponsorship for this specific role. Below presents additional info for your
reference. (Data Powered by US Department of Labor)
Distribution of Different Job Fields Receiving Sponsorship
Represents job field similar to this job
Trends of Total Sponsorships
2025 (210)
Funding
Current Stage
Public CompanyTotal Funding
$713.58M2025-06-06Post Ipo Secondary· $713.58M
2015-10-21Acquired
1995-11-17IPO
Recent News
2026-01-24
Investing.com
2026-01-24
Company data provided by crunchbase